Great Tastes At SunTree Benefits Brevard Charities
By Space Coast Daily // October 8, 2014
event set for Saturday, October 11
BREVARD COUNTY • SUNTREE, FLORIDA – The SunTree Rotary Foundation has joined forces with the Boys and Girls Club, the Children’s Hunger Project of Brevard and Promise in Brevard for its largest event yet.

This year, the event is scheduled for Saturday, October 11 from 5:30 to 8:30 p.m. The Great Tastes at SunTree is the SunTree Rotary Foundation’s primary fundraising vehicle.
The event features 30+ local restaurants and a chance to network with others in the SunTree community.
Last year’s event set new records for the Foundation in terms of both fundraising and participation, and we expect this year’s event to be even larger and better.
Proceeds from this year’s Great Tastes at SunTree will go to three of Brevard children’s charities: The Boys & Girls Club, The Children’s Hunger Project of Brevard and Promise in Brevard.
For the admission price of $30, patrons will enjoy food and live entertainment in the ambiance of a country club setting.
A cash bar will be available.
Given the current economic challenges, we are excited about what this event will do for the children of Brevard.
The SunTree Rotary Foundation is a 501c3 non-profit organization. The Foundation works in partnership with the SunTree Rotary Club to advance the mission of Rotary International.
